Da Gaon No 5

Da Gaon No 5 is a village located in Sarupathar subdivision of Golaghat district in Assam,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Bokajan (tehsildar office) and 76km away from district headquarter Golaghat. As per 2009 stats, Chungajan Mikir Villages is the gram panchayat of Da Gaon No 5 village.

About Da Gaon No 5

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Da Gaon No 5 is 295159. The village spans a total geographical area of 225.69 hectares. Bokajan is nearest town to Da Gaon No 5 village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Da Gaon No 5

Below is a concise population overview of Da Gaon No 5 as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,118 607 511
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 168 89 79
Scheduled Castes (SC) 17 6 11
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 12 7 5
Literate Population 705 439 266
Illiterate Population 413 168 245

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Da Gaon No 5 village:

  • The total population of Da Gaon No 5 village is around 1,118, including approximately 607 males and 511 females, with a sex ratio of 841 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 168 children aged 0–6 years in Da Gaon No 5 village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Da Gaon No 5 village has 17 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 12 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Da Gaon No 5 village is about 63.06%, with male literacy at 72.32% and female literacy at 52.05%.
  • There are around 171 households in Da Gaon No 5 village.

Connectivity of Da Gaon No 5

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Da Gaon No 5. As per the 2011 stats, Da Gaon No 5 had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
